Buyer's todo before going to view homes:
  1. Get Pre-Qualified with a reputable lender. The lender will issue you a commitment letter. You will need this letter to submit an offer.
  2. Work with your lender to create a worksheet for you. Know your desirable purchase price, type of loandownpayment, and closing costs required. This will allow you to have a clear picture of how much cash you will need at closing, how much you can ask from seller to contribute and time needed for financing process to close. For example, with USDA loan with zero down you will need minimum 45 days to close.
  3. Determine the area you like to focus on and drive around to get a good understanding of roads, traffic patterns, access to shops and schools. I suggest to start with Google Maps!
  4. Receive and review current list of homes for sale from your realtor. NOTE: some listings in popular areas that are priced right receive multiple offers within a day. But since you have done all the home work (see above) you are a great contender to win a bid. Remember, overbidding is possible in a hot market, but the property must appraise to the sales price or above. If the property does not appraise the seller risks to lose contract. The seller should lower the price to the appraised value. Unless there are cash buyers - the seller will face this situation with any conventional buyer.
  5. MAKE DECISION FAST! Buying in Spring is not the same as buying in November. Now decisions must be made fast and there is no time to "think about it later" on any properly priced and good condition property for sale!
